VISI Selects ParaScale Software Paired With Commodity Linux Servers For Its Soon-To-Be-Launched

ParaScale, Inc., a startup company developing cloud storage software solutions, today announced that VISI..
 

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

PR Log (Press Release)Sep 04, 2009 – CUPERTINO, CA —  ParaScale, Inc., a startup company developing cloud storage software solutions, today announced that VISI(http://www.visi.com) , a leading Minnesota-based regional provider of enterprise managed hosting services, has selected ParaScale software as the cloud storage platform to enable a transition into cloud services.

“We are excited to have completed our platform selection process for our soon-to-be-announced cloud computing services,” said Jason Baker, CTO of VISI.  “After a detailed evaluation, we have selected ParaScale as the basis of our cloud storage offering. This is a critical decision for us, as this foundational technology is going to be with us for a long time. We were particularly impressed by the fact that ParaScale delivers a complete solution including easy data access, a comprehensive storage infrastructure and simple integration with our existing systems. Not only is ParaScale putting its best foot forward as a technology provider, they are focused on helping service providers offer a unique and differentiated offering.”

Cloud storage(http://www.parascale.com) continues to be a focus and starting point for many providers looking to offer cloud services. Meanwhile, cloud computing (renting CPU cycles by the hour) is a medium term opportunity. It is more complex for the hosting company to deliver, while still requiring the end-customer to have the expertise and time to package up an application to run in the cloud.  “Cloud storage is the ideal starting point for cloud providers as it is an easier entry point to the market segment when compared with the cost and complexity of integrating other cloud computing technologies, and customers are buying it,” said Antonio Piraino, analyst at Tier-1 Research. “Cloud services overall are growing at 100% year-over-year for the foreseeable future. In a tough economic environment, this is one of the few bright spots.”

By combining ParaScale software and buyer selected standard servers, managed service providers can build different types of storage clouds and offer a variety of storage cloud services.

“It is very gratifying that VISI selected ParaScale as the foundation of their imminent cloud storage service,” said Cameron Bahar, founder and CTO, ParaScale, Inc. This is especially so because the technically and strategically astute VISI team performed in-depth testing including acquiring and testing competitive products. With all the noise around cloud storage, it is not easy for service providers to separate the hype from the reality.”

“Amazon and Google set out to build a massive pool of file storage based on commodity hardware and in doing so, created the concept of cloud storage,” said Sajai Krishnan, CEO of ParaScale.  “Given the interest in this emerging market, many archival storage vendors have positioned themselves as players in the cloud storage space as they can scale capacity, but the ability to deliver cloud-scale performance is missing. Another vendor claims to be a cloud storage platform without storing any bits and others tout proprietary REST APIs as the be-all, ignoring the proprietary lessons of the past.  In beating out a set of traditional and new storage players, VISI validated ParaScale as the best all-around platform for service providers to pursue the rapidly evolving cloud storage opportunity. We are humbled by VISI's vote of confidence, and recognize that we win not with this first purchase, but when VISI has a profitable petabyte-plus storage cloud.”

About VISI:
Founded in 1994, VISI is Minnesota's largest locally owned data center services and managed hosting provider, offering connectivity, colocation and managed cloud computing services. VISI serves 10,000 business and residential customers throughout Minnesota with products and services including a world-class SAS 70 Type II data center in St. Paul, Minnesota. The company provides a full range of robust Web and application hosting services, first-rate Internet services and support, and personal, expert advice.
